I’ve bought three laptops this year from eBay. The second was shortly after the first because I thought it was such a good deal.

A few months later the first laptops exhaust started smelling like burning plastic and i also discovered that if you move the lid/screen a certain way the laptop hard freezes. A few months after that same smell from the second laptop (different model/seller) that progressed into a proper burning smell. In both cases I’m out my purchase price and for the total could have bought new.

On a whim after coming across the thinkpad subreddit I bought a t480s recently. As soon as I got it paid attention to folding the hinges excessively and noticed it creaks sometimes and the exhaust also gets a little too toasty. So this one is going back.

I’m not against used. I’m a lifelong 2nd hand buyer. No problems with phones or even mini pcs.

I don’t recommend laptops anymore tho. Too delicate and can have hidden issues.

If you read this far. It’s not enviornmental cus my bought new laptop (4yo) doesn’t have any issues. And also I did take off the back cover in both laptops and didn’t see any obvious blown parts. And neither are overheating from sensor data even under p95

Twitter enables this through not checking the account in a URL... a simple fix would be to actually respect the Twitter URL components, if the account doesnt match the linked tweet, don't redirect...

Right now you can spoof (just as far as the URL displayed in an anchor tag) the account to be whatever you like:

Example:

https://twitter.com/elonmusk/status/1745190441539293271

This will redirect you to the following, but as content within a tweet, it will look like a legit post from Elon. Crypto-scams are using this in every single post.

https://twitter.com/ElonMuskAOC/status/1745190441539293271
